Has an NCAA Men's Basketball game ever ended 73-22?
Exactly once. On January 6, 2005, Boston University Terriers beat Hartford Hawks 73-22, and no NCAA Men's Basketball game before or since has ended that way. When it happened it was a scorigami, the first 73-22 in league history.
That makes 73-22 the 3013th most common final score out of 3,845 that have ever occurred in NCAA Men's Basketball. One point away, 74-22 has happened never and 73-23 has happened never.
